In her first published novella, Edith Wharton tells the story of a financially destitute man, Stephen Glennard, who chances upon a scheme that allows him to make a fortune and enter into an advantageous marriage—by betraying his former, recently deceased lover.

Edith Wharton (1862-1937) was a Pulitzer Prize-winning American novelist and short story writer. Acclaimed for her depiction of privileged society at the turn of the 20th century and the conflicts between money and morals, she is the author of The House of Mirth, The Age of Innocence, and Ethan Frome.
